The fictional Moira Rose, played by Catherine O'Hara for years on the popular sitcom "Schitt's Creek," was a spoiled, eccentric, and overly dramatic character. Her namesake, the talented 3-year ...
The Canadian sitcom Schitt’s Creek follows the Rose family consisting of Johnny (Eugene Levy), Moira (Catherine O’Hara) and their two adult children, David (Dan Levy) and Alexis (Annie Murphy).
